Characterizations of some free random variables by properties of conditional moments of third degree polynomials
Abstract
We investigate Laha-Lukacs properties of noncommutative random variables (processes). We prove that some families of free Meixner distributions can be characterized by the conditional moments of polynomial functions of degree 3. We also show that this fact has consequences in describing some free Levy processes. The proof relies on a combinatorial identity. At the end of this paper we show that this result can be extended to a q-Gausian variable.
